About Clayfield 4011

The size of Clayfield is approximately 2.8 square kilometres. There are 4 parks, covering nearly 1.6% of the total area. The population of Clayfield in 2016 was 10555 people. By 2021 the population was 10897 showing a population growth of 3.2%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Clayfield is 30-39 years. Households in Clayfield are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Clayfield work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 55.00% of the homes in Clayfield were owner-occupied compared with 52.40% in 2016.

Clayfield has 6,329 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Clayfield have seen a 55.94%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 124.91% increase. As at 30 April 2026:

  • The median value for Houses in Clayfield is $2,140,512 while the median value for Units is $883,609.
  • Houses have a median rent of $850 while Units have a median rent of $600.
There are currently 36 properties listed for sale, and 9 properties listed for rent in Clayfield on OnTheHouse. According to Cotality's data, 307 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Clayfield.
